This page allows you to copy the part program to multiple parts. Tell me more.

The “Copy Program to Part #” page appears.

The system displays the following in the “Copy From” group box:

Part #

The number identifying the part whose details are to be copied.

Part Description

The textual description of the part.

Zoom facility available.

Maintenance Process

The maintenance process of the part which could be “Hard-Time”, “On-Condition” or “Condition Monitoring”.

Part #

The number identifying the part to which the details are to be copied. The part should have already been defined in the "Create Parts Main Information” activity of the “Part Administration” business component and must be in the “Active” status. Also the maintenance program should not have already been defined for the part.

This page allows you to copy the part program to multiple parts. You can enter the part number to which the part program details are to be copied. The system displays the description of the part. The system copies the work units, resource and part requirement, and the schedule information of the parts entered in the multiline. The system updates the details and stores the name of the currently logged in user and the current server date.
